    I am so sad I did not take any photos to show everyone I meet in the next weeks what probably was my favorite meal of 2025. The ambiance in this restaurant is outstanding and you can truly feel the attention to detail that goes into every element even beyond the food itself, this also might possibly be the best lit restaurant I have been in a while. Being sat directly in front of the chefs felt like the best seat in the house, there is something incredibly joyous watching the whole process of someone taking so much care to prepare a dish and then seeing it make its way to your table. Service is incredibly welcoming, there are delicious wines by the glass and just one look at the wine list makes you plan your next visit. House non alcoholic drinks are not to be missed as well and their bright acidity pairs well with the food without overpowering it. Perfect sourdough, expertly fermented golden kimchi, what can only be described as an elegant take on cod crudo with an incredibly well balanced amount of aromatics. Every dish works together with the next while no two things seem like they’re from the same universe. Cuttle fish is served warm, hearty, comforting, melt in your mouth chickpeas, sauce that makes you order more bread, fare la scarpetta for every plate at the end, almost an additional course in itself after you finish the main event, how could you not. We only tried one dessert and I will probably never come close to conveying how much it genuinely tasted like sourdough and jam while actually being two scoops of ice cream. Thank you so much for everything, whenever I’m back in London I will definitely plan my schedule around coming here again.

    Great service! The individual roasts were a good size, but the sharing suckling lamb advertised for two wasn't really filling, not much meat on the bone. Could've been easily eaten by only one person; it would have been more convenient to order two individual dishes. The sticky toffee pudding was a winner, but the pear dessert was a bit of a steal.. £8 for less than half a pear and a splash of cream.
